core/memory: handle Fixed mapping with zero addr in callers (#4507)

Add check in sceKernelReserveVirtualRange, sceKernelMapNamedDirectMemory, and
sceKernelMapNamedFlexibleMemory per StevenMiller123 review:
- FW >= 1.70 returns EINVAL for Fixed + addr == 0
- Older FW clears Fixed flag to fall through to managed allocation
